Geographic Location of Amahar


The village Amahar is located in Ghorawal Tahsil of Sonbhadra District in the State of Uttar Pradesh in India. It is governed by Amaud Gram Panchayat. It comes under Ghorawal Community Development Block. The nearest town is Sonbhadra, which is about 16 kilometers away from Amahar.

Social Structure of Amahar


As per available data from the year 2009, 751 persons live in 106 house holds in the village Amahar. There are 347 female individuals and 404 male individuals in the village. Females constitute 46.21% and males constitute 53.79% of the total population.

There are 113 scheduled castes persons of which 56 are females and 57 are males. Females constitute 49.56% and males constitute 50.44% of the scheduled castes population. Scheduled castes constitute 15.05% of the total population.

Population density of Amahar is 1608.48 persons per square kilometer.

Land and Natural Resources in Amahar

Total area of Amahar is 46.69 Hectares as per the data available for the year 2009.

Total sown/agricultural area is 35 ha. About 35 ha is un-irrigated area.

About 0.19 ha is in non-agricultural use.

About 3 ha is lying as current fallow area. About 0.5 ha is culturable waste land. About 8 ha is covered by barren and un-cultivable land.
